Kodak’s World’s Largest Puzzle costs $409.99 and is now available on Amazon. Is it truly the biggest jigsaw puzzle in the world, as it says?

It may very well be, considering that Ravensburger claims to have the current Guinness Book of World Records record-holder for the largest commercially-available puzzle in the world — but that puzzle, called “Memorable Disney Moments,” boasts only 40,320 pieces. Kodak’s “World’s Largest Puzzle”

The puzzle probably won’t fit on your dining room table, so make sure you have adequate space before you consider purchasing it. This giant Kodak product has a total of 51,300 pieces  — yes, you read that right, 51 thousand pieces — and measures approximately 28.5 feet by 6.25 feet when finished.

If this seems overwhelming, consider that the puzzle is actually a collection of 27 separately-packaged puzzle images. Each individual puzzle has 1,900 pieces and measures 39 inches by 24 inches when completed.

Travel The World From Home—With A Puzzle

The puzzle is named “27 Wonders from Around the World,” and with good reason. Every individual part of the giant puzzle began as a photo taken by a professional photographer. The pictures have been digitally enhanced and printed in high quality to create parts of the whole. The photos include scenes such as the New York City skyline, the Colosseum in Italy and Neuschwanstein Castle in Germany.

An image reference poster is included with the puzzle package. After you have put all 27 individual puzzles together, they will interlock, resulting in one enormous puzzle.
